[Q] Android file system with SD vs no SD

I'm coming from a phone with very low internal memory to one with 16GB. My question is around all the app data and where it would go in a phone with 16gb internal memory and not SD card.
Reason I ask is I would love to have all my apps stored internally and use my SD card mostly for music/pics..
Would this work or will apps put data in the SD if one is present.
another question would be what would happen if I have no SD card for a while, then I introduce the SD card..
All the data would be kept on the internal storage, which would be seen as a internal memory stick. If you put a microSD card in then it will store some data on the SD card but you could move it back by going to settings>applications>manage applications>on sd card

[Q] please help me i have problem

i brought micro sd card for my phone it has phone memory 500 mb sd card 2 gb cant remove it and i buyed 16 gb so i want to install apps on my phone to new 16 gb card so i cant do it when i want to change preferred install location here is only 1st phone storage and 2nd 2gb card so what do to install apps on 16 gb card?
P.S i can delete write files on 16 gb card
Are you saying your phone has 2GB internal memory or a 2GB removable SD card? If it's a removable card, all you need to do is copy all the files to a folder on your computer, put the 16GB card in your phone, format it, then copy everything back from the comp to phone.
If the 2GB memory is internal (noted as 'SD card' by the system in some devices), then by default apps are installed here and not on the external SD card (removable card). There are ways to do it though, but they are phone specific and depend on whether a dev has made such a method work for your phone.

[Q] Merging phone storage and internal sd

Hello,
I recently bought a Lenovo A820 and am currently using LambdaROM 2.3.5a. My phone has 4GB of internal space and I have a 8GB microSD card in it as well. My internal storage is running low, but my internal sd card is empty and cannot be used, because I've all things on the external sd. Is there anyway to merge the internal sd card with the internal phone storage? I've searched long and hard already, but found no concrete information. I know I can swap memories and even link my sd card to the phone storage. But my internal storage is 4GB which only 2GB are being used for the phone storage and 2GB are partitioned to the internal sd card. I would like to merge them into the internal phone storage, if possible. My question is: is it possible? If so, how can I do it?
Thank you.
Bump for ZLR/ALPS F9006
Hi
You cannot merge virtual internal SD and physical external SD into one volume.
However you can probably swap it - which should solve all of your problems.
Your phone has MTK6589 chip, so the process will be similar as on my Snopow: http://forum.xda-developers.com/showthread.php?t=2777140
After the swap external SD will be visible as internal SD and the other way round. That means you can buy 64GB SD card and have all this space available for installing apps because phone will see this card as internal storage.
